Creating screenshots
You can create screenshots of the current user interface directly on the TCU.
Each screenshot is saved as a file and stored in the following folder:
/user/sinumerik/hmi/log/screenshot

Press the <Ctrl+P> key combination.
A screenshot of the current user interface is created in .png format.
The file names assigned by the system run in ascending order from
"SCR_SAVE_0001.png" to "SCR_SAVE_9999". You can create up to 9,999
screenshots.
1.
Select the "Startup" operating area.
2.
Press the "System data" softkey and open the specified folder.
As you cannot open screenshots in the HMI sl, you must copy the files
to a Windows PC either via WinSCP or via a USB FlashDrive.
You can open the files using a graphics program, e.g. "Office Picture
Manager".
